BMA Law is a specialist healthcare law firm that was established as an ABS in 2015 by the British Medical Association, which is the trade union and professional association for doctors and medical students in the UK.

The role involves advising on corporate/commercial and regulatory matters for members of the BMA and other external clients, and on occasion the internal departments and committees of the BMA itself.

It provides an outstanding opportunity for any solicitor who is looking to utilise and develop their skills on both a legal and business-related footing within a skilled, dynamic and supportive environment that operates within the healthcare sector.

Working closely with the BMA, the BMA Law team is at the forefront of healthcare policy and legislative change and can be asked to advise on matters that can potentially impact the medical profession as a whole.  Due to our relationship with the BMA the role combines the best aspects of private practice and working in house.

You will need to be a corporate/commercial solicitor with at least 2 years’ post qualification experience (PQE) to join our growing team of lawyers who deal with a busy and diverse caseload.  Healthcare experience is beneficial but by no means essential.  This position would also suit a solicitor with general commercial experience gained in private practice, who is now looking for an opportunity to progress by specialising in the healthcare field with support from a team of expert lawyers.

In 2015 we became licensed as a fully independent law firm, allowing us to provide you with a full range of services. Whether you are a GP Partner in need of a new partnership agreement, a group of GP practices who want to establish a network, or a doctor looking to update your Will, we have the expertise to support you at home as well as at work.

In addition to providing legal services to you and your family, we also act as the BMA’s legal services provider – meaning we stand with them at the forefront of medical policy to represent your needs.

You do not need to be a BMA member to use our services, but if you are, you will benefit from discounted rates. We provide support across the medical community, including:

  • Doctors
  • Medical students
  • GP practices and GP networks/federations
  • Local Medical Committees
  • Clinical Commissioning Groups
